Maybe you've heard about the famous British sense of humor or the American parody that makes everyone laugh uncontrollably. Perhaps you are one of the guests at the popular comedy basement or even a viewer of some of the most amazing sitcoms like Seinfeld and Friends.
However, many may not be too familiar with the Scottish sense of humor, which is something a whole corner of Reddit has committed itself to. This Reddit group has more than 760K members, and it’s called "Scottish People Twitter."
The subreddit is a hub for some of the entertaining and hilarious things Scots have posted on the internet, and it is pure, unadulterated comedy gold that we didn't realize we really wanted. Veloglasglow, who happens to be the moderator of this subreddit, says that Scots, for the most part, have a sense of humor that is dry, dark, and direct.
So, it is practically incomprehensible not to appreciate it. Most importantly, there is an assumption that a nationally shared sense of humor exists.
Is it truly possible for millions of individuals to make the same type of joke and find exactly the same things hilarious? Well, how about we find out as we’ve gathered 30 of the best tweets from the Scottish People Twitter group for your entertainment.
